码迷,mamicode.com
首页 >  
搜索关键字:quick-sort    ( 227个结果
快速排序
快速排序 ~~~~ void quick_sort(int q[], int l, int r) { if (l = r)return; int i = l 1, j = r + 1, x = q[l + r 1]; while (i x); if (i < j) swap(q[i], q[j]); ...
分类:编程语言   时间:2020-01-08 20:49:43    阅读次数:90
C 语言快速排序算法以及 qsort
运行结果 sort data: [8.6] [1.2] [5.1] [8.3] [6.5] [4.8] [5.3] [5.3] [7.3] [3.6] quick_sort: [1.2] [3.6] [4.8] [5.1] [5.3] [5.3] [6.5] [7.3] [8.3] [8.6] li ...
分类:编程语言   时间:2020-01-07 13:13:35    阅读次数:78
快速排序
将数组A[p...p]划分成两个子数组A[p...q-1]和A[q+1,r],使得A[p...q-1]的每一个元素都小于等于A[q],A[q]也小于等于A[q+1,r]中的每个元素。 实现快速排序 void quick_sort(int A[], int p, int r) { int q; if ...
分类:编程语言   时间:2020-01-07 11:44:39    阅读次数:99
QuickSort 快速排序
# QuickSort 快速排序_Python实现 def quick_sort(li): if len(li) < 2: return li # 选取基准值, 一般选取第一个, 并将其从中剔除 # mid = li[0] # li.remove(mid) mid = li.pop(0) # 定义左 ...
分类:编程语言   时间:2019-12-26 09:23:51    阅读次数:137
快速排序
$arr= array(2,13,42,34,56,23,67,365,87665,54,68,3); $info = quick_sort($arr); print_r($info); function quick_sort($arr){ if(count($arr) <= 1){ return ...
分类:编程语言   时间:2019-12-24 09:18:28    阅读次数:67
排序与查找
文章目录查找搜索引擎线性查找(顺序查找)二分查找排序桶排序(计数排序)选择排序(交换排序上改进)冒泡排序快速排序(Quick Sort)插入一个数据到有序数列中 查找 搜索引擎 matching & ranking 索引技术 AltaVista:foward index 文档到关键词 / inver ...
分类:编程语言   时间:2019-12-17 20:29:26    阅读次数:136
快速排序(python实现)
def quick_sort(alist, start, end): """快速排序""" # 递归的退出条件 if start >= end: return # 设定起始元素为要寻找位置的基准元素 mid = alist[start] # low 为序列左边的由左向右移动的游标 low = sta ...
分类:编程语言   时间:2019-12-14 09:19:08    阅读次数:101
【PAT甲级】1101 Quick Sort (25 分)
题意: 输入一个正整数N(<=1e5),接着输入一行N个各不相同的正整数。输出可以作为快速排序枢纽点的个数并升序输出这些点的值。 trick: 测试点2格式错误原因:当答案为0时,需要换行两次??。。。。。这是为何 AAAAAccepted code: 1 #define HAVE_STRUCT_T ...
分类:其他好文   时间:2019-12-02 19:26:02    阅读次数:116
3. 快速排序
快速排序(Quick Sort)与冒泡排序均为交换类排序。快排是对冒泡排序的一种改进。由于关键字的比较和交换是跳跃进行的,因此,快速排序是一种不稳定的排序方法。 0. 序 1. 冒泡排序 2. 快速排序 2.1 基本思想 2.2 一趟快速排序(一趟划分) 2.3 过程 2.4 实现 2.5 复杂度分 ...
分类:编程语言   时间:2019-11-30 11:13:46    阅读次数:119
A1101 Quick Sort (25 分)
一、技术总结 1. 这里的一个关键就是理解调换位置排序是时,如果是元主,那么它要确保的条件就只有两个一个是,自己的位置不变,还有就是前面的元素不能有比自己大的。 二、参考代码 ...
分类:其他好文   时间:2019-11-20 13:02:34    阅读次数:69
227条   上一页 1 2 3 4 5 ... 23 下一页
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!